I can't seem to find any reason that CompilerSelect shouldn't work with strings,
CompilerIf works like a charm. I know CompilerSelect is not supposed to support that
and it's also mentioned in the help. Is there a specific reason for this behavior except
that it just isn't implemented at the moment?

If not I'd like to make a feature request.
